Certain dried fruits can be great sources of iron. Dried prunes and apricots, for example, have a similar iron content to some servings of meat. However, dried fruit can also have high sugar content. WebJun 6, 2024 · DRIED APRICOTS 2.7 mg Apricots, especially dried ones, are a rich source of plant-based iron as they provide your body with 2.7mg of this mineral per 3.5oz (100g) serving. This fruit also contains a lot of potassium (1162mg), phosphorus (71.0mg), calcium (55.0mg), and magnesium (32.0mg).
